03/02 Director Candidates Nominated in Districts 2, 5, & 8
District meetings with director nominations were held in February. Three incumbent directors were nominated without opposition in Districts 2, 5, and 8: District 2: Dennis Mathiason District 5: Charles Kvare District 8: Sid Wisness

02/08 February CEO Message: Giving the Gift of Light
This December three of our linemen had a unique opportunity to help bring electricity to the people of Haiti. It is an incredible feeling for our co-op in Minnesota to be able to help people living thousands of miles away. By traveling to Haiti, our linemen were able to directly assist the people there and improve their quality of life. Many areas in Haiti still lack the basic electric infrastructure that we take for granted here. LREC’s linemen joined Haitian crews to construct a large three-phase project serving a primarily residential area.

12/12 CEO Column: December 2016 — Rate Increase Approved for 2017
During its October meeting the Lake Region Electric Board of Directors approved a 4.3% overall rate increase effective on January 1st, 2017. The actual percentage varies according to rate class and can differ for individual members based on their electric consumption. LREC last increased rates in 2013 and off-peak heating rates haven’t changed since 2008. In fact, since 2013 LREC has been able to offset or absorb over $3 million in wholesale power cost increases.
12/09 Capital Credits Approved
Your board of directors recently approved the retirement of $1.15 million in patronage capital credits in 2016. This is equal to 2.5% of equity. People and organizations who were members of Lake Region Electric Cooperative in 1990 and 1991 are receiving capital credit retirements.
12/02 2017 District Meeting Schedule
Candidates for the LREC Board of Directors will be nominated in districts 2, 5, and 8. There will be a meeting held in each of the three nominating districts. You are invited to attend any meeting, although only members of nominating districts will be allowed to vote.
